Coleman LED Quad Lantern

An area light and four portable lanterns in one clever unit, the Coleman LED Quad Lantern is a versatile choice for indoors or outdoors. The Quad Lantern’s four removable panels hold 24 LEDs total. Each of the four sections can be removed and carried as a portable light to go to the shower house, tent, or wherever one of your group needs some light. When the sections are returned to the lantern base, they easily reattach and immediately start to recharge as well as illuminate. The Quad Lantern features six 5mm white LEDs in each panel (24 total), shedding 190 lumens of light. The wide-angle LEDs are behind a textured lens for dispersed lighting. Each section also has a handle on top to carry it or hang it. A main on/off switch is located on top of the lantern; each removable section also has its own switch. Powered by eight D-cell batteries (not included) that are housed in the lantern base, the LED Quad Lantern operates for up to 30 hours. Each of the four panels also contains an included rechargeable NiMH battery that powers the panel while in use away from the base. When docked back into the base station, each panel is recharged from the main D-cell. Review by Wildness:

I have been a long time believer in only using propane lanterns when car camping. Previous battery operated lanterns with florescent bulbs that I have tried have always lacked for sufficient light to eat by let alone cook or setup a tent with.

But, then I discovered the Coleman LED Quad Lantern and everything has changed. This is, by far, the best camping lantern I have ever used! Not only is it super bright, it is smaller and more convenient than a propane lantern – especially since I no longer need to tote around gas canisters.

But, this lantern is more than just a lantern; it provides for personal lighting needs as well. Each of the lantern’s four light panels detach and work as rechargeable hand lamps for that rummage in the back of the truck for gear or the scramble to the bathroom sight in the middle of the night. And, with a 1-1/2 hour charge time, that makes these light panels useful for reading in the tent, etc.

It is not only this lantern’s overall design that make it great, but the attention to little things as well. For example, the rechargeable light panels are powered by standard AA rechargeable batteries. Unlike other rechargeable light systems where the battery is sealed and inaccessible, if a battery eventually fails, it can be easily replaced with a standard, off the shelf rechargeable battery.

No more propane, no more broken mantles, no more trying to light a propane lantern in the dark. The Coleman LED Quad Lantern is the lantern of the future that I bet all competitors will try to copy.

Coleman Rugged Battery Powered Lantern (Family Size)

Lantern, 8D Double U-Tube RuggedLight up your campsite with instant, long-lasting illumination with the Coleman rugged battery-powered lantern. The family-size lantern boasts a 13-watt fluorescent twin U-tube bulb that delivers a bright white light, along with a heavy-duty thermoplastic and rubber housing that holds up to heavy use. More significantly, the lantern will keep your tent well lit for hours, with a runtime of up to 28 hours on the low setting and 18 hours on the high setting (the lantern runs on eight D batteries, sold separately). And should the bulb eventually burn out, you can replace it in seconds thanks to the lantern’s quick-release system. Other details include a comfortable handle grip, an easy three-position switch (off, low, and high), a weather- and shatter-resistant exterior, and a nonslip rubberized grip. The lantern–which runs cool thanks to the cool-touch bulb design–measures 9 inches in diameter and 15.25 inches tall and weighs 3.26 pounds without the batteries. About Coleman
The Coleman Company has been creating and innovating products for recreational outdoor use since W.C. Coleman started selling gasoline-powered lanterns in 1900. Inventor of the hugely popular fold-up camp stove, Coleman developed a plastic liner for his galvanized steel coolers in 1957–the birth of the modern cooler–and the company has been improving their utility and design ever since. The array of products that bear the Coleman name now includes just about everything you might need to work or play outdoors, from tents and sleeping bags to boats, backpacks, and furniture.

Review by Kent Vaughn:

Used this for the first time this past weekend, so I’ve only had limited experience so far. (I’ll update this review if I run into a problem later.) Some brief highlights:

* The lantern works quite well. It puts out a good deal of light and is well constructed.

*Like other reviewers, I am concerned about the possibility of cross threading the soft aluminum header in the lantern versus the propane tanks. When attached the propane, take your time and be careful not to over tighten.

* I think it is well worth the money to buy the version with the hard case. It is a nice case, easy to put the lantern away and makes is great to pack.

* Like any propane product, there is some propane “hiss” while it burns, but I didn’t find it bothersome. Possibly I expected some, so wasn’t surprised.

* This lantern does NOT have a ignition built in,so you have to use a match or a small torch, but it was easy enough to light.

Overall, a good lantern. We’ll see how it holds up with time. The only reason for the 4stars instead of 5 is the issue with the soft aluminum threads.

Review by SkinDiver:

Just received this product so I will defer commenting on battery life until later. Overall I have been very pleased and surprised with this product. First off, this lantern is fairly compact…I was under the impression that this would be larger from the pictures but once I opened it up, I was pleasingly surprised. The unit is very compact and feels very sturdy. There is rubber on the base and around the lower portion of the lantern, the switch is very easy to operate and has 3-modes (High, Low, and Strobe). The entire top/globe can be unscrewed and hung upside down (clip in the base) to use as a room or tent light in “bare bulb” mode. Overall I have been very impressed with the output of this lantern as well. This is a very bright lantern for it’s compact size; outshining normal 4D fluorescent U-tubed lanterns and a coleman pack-away LED lantern. The diffuser is also very pleasing with no rings, lines, or shadows to speak of. In bare bulb mode, the light is almost too bright for your eyes but works well if it’s hung high overhead (so you’re not looking directly at the unit). Low mode is also very useful and brighter than your typical “nightlight” levels in other LED lanterns “low” modes. Overall I am very impressed with this product and plan to purchase more of these units for use while night fishing, camping, and to use during power failures.

Update (10/31/09): Just an update, I recently used this light in a power outage and it performed great. Bright and the batteries are still going strong. I also purchased 2 additional units and with just 3-D batteries each, who can complain! This is a great compact lantern.

Review by R. Scholer:

Let me start off by saying that this is overall a VERY good product, but receives 3 stars for a design flaw.

The green LED is ALWAYS blinking, even with the main switch “off”. This constant parasitic drain on the batteries ruins my intended use of a long-term storage emergency light for the house.

I did call Rayovac on this issue and they said that it will drain the batteries in 32 days. This cannot be accurate and I know that this small load will take MUCH longer than 32 days to drain the batteries. Still, for my purpose I now must remove the batteries and fumble in the dark to put them in during a power failure.

The difficult battery cover (mentioned by many in the reviews) does not help this issue!

Yet another product that is ALMOST great. I would have bought many more of these for family members to use as emergency lights, but now have to find a better option where the batteries will still be full after long term storage.

Review by Nats:

I like this little LED lantern. You can adjust the amount of light you need. Even on the highest setting, it does not seem very bright, but if you are in total darkness, like a power outage, it is perfectly fine for

doing what you need to do. Yes, it could stand to be a little brighter.

The biggest problem I have with it is, the glass is clear, and there is nothing to filter the glare of the LED and reflector. It’s very annoying. I solved the problem by cutting a 4 1/2 X 10” strip of white tissue paper and wrapping it around the glass. Not only did this fix the glare, the tissue paper also acts as a “diffuser” and spreads the light evenly, and softly in every direction without effecting the overal brightness. It just made it softer, and more pleasant. The lamp does not get hot, so no worries. I have had the light on high all night, no problems.

So, with the tissue paper diffuser I give it a 4 star rating, without the diffuser, I would give it 2 stars, simply because the glare is so annoying.

Review by W. Crawford:

I just got this lantern. I’m testing it out using hi capacity NiMH rechargeables. Works very nicely. I’ve got 13 hours so far on high, and still going strong. I returned a 4D collapseable version. Biggest drawback on the 4D pack-away, besides its lower light output with its convoluted reflector system was that it flickered sometimes due to the sliding contacts inside used to turn it off automatically when collapsed. This model of course does not exhibit that problem.

Build quality of this model is pretty good. Battery holder is a little flimsy. Light output is nothing to really gripe about. It’s good, but of course more is always better. Somewhere around 10 hours on high, and 20+ on low would still be acceptable and Low would then be as bright as this current model is on high. That would pretty much maximize this lantern using 8 D-cells, and would make it superior in light output and efficiency to any older flourescent models, and pretty much obsolete them altogether.

Coleman has just offered another new model above this one with 4 removeable panels that will run on their own. It has 24 conventional type LEDs, and looks solidly built out of a thermoplastic though not too water resitant looking design (could be wrong on that upon a closer inspection). It’s selling now at Bass Pro Shop for , but I don’t like the aesthetics of it. It’s not very nice looking like a classic lantern.

I’d like to see this model beefed up just a little more on the output with a little more robust battery holder and an improved ring around the base for slippage and or more protection.

If Coleman wants to support “green” initiatives as an outdoors company, then for those of us who will use NiMHs, or the newest generation low self-leakage NiMHs, the battery holder and springs could be more robust for more frequent battery changes. (Coleman’s rechargeable version of this lantern should be good for most not wanting separates, but the self contained model has lower light output, and lasts less time on a charge than going hi-cap D-cells in this one. Plus, when the cells go bad, I won’t have to buy a new lantern, or pay as much as a new one for a custom replacement battery and/or service.) The plastic on this one’s battery holder is fairly thin, and the springs are very thin. Feels delicate enough that one should use caution changing batteries, or it might crack and bend springs. It’s a bit flimsy for my tastes with flexing so be careful.

I’d really like to see some rubber around the base or an integrated bead around the edge of the lip. The thin liped, hard plastic edge on the bottom seems like it might wind up getting some chunks broken out of it for some harder users, or from sitting it on the ground in rocky terrain rather than just picnic tables.

It appears that this lantern wins the beauty contest for sure, but that Coleman’s new panelized lantern would probably win a durability test.
